PURPOSE: To obtain an electric wave absorber having an excellent oblique incident property, by using a plural number of layers in which the content of the conductive particle increases successively and at the same time forming the cross section of the final layer into a triangle using the arriving direction of the electric wave for the apex.
CONSTITUTION: The electric wave absorber is formed by connecting the unit blocks A in a desired number. The block A is composed of layers 1∼4, and the content of the conductive particle is minimum in the layer 1 that serves as the projection face of the electric wave and then increases successively toward the layers 2 and 3 to be maximum at the layer 4. The layer 1 is composed of a plural number of elements 1a having a cross section of an equilateral triangle, and the layer 2 is formed with a rectangular cross section. The layer 4 has a cross section of an equilateral triangle with its vertical angle touching the rear face of the layer 2. And the base opposite to the vertical angle is distributed nearly in parallel to the base of the element 1a. With such distribution of the layer 4, the layer 3 having a triangular cross section is provided in the space between the layers 4 and 2. In such constitution, an excellent obliquie incident property can be obtained.
